Kelp noodles have a surprising crunchy and refreshing texture—similar to bean sprouts. They're neutral enough to take on assertive flavors, like a fresh ginger and miso dressing.
After the kelp noodles have soaked in warm water for a few minutes, rinse them, and let them drain in a colander. Pat dry with paper towel. Cut through the noodles a little so they are not so long.
